{"data":{"id":"us-az/a.r.s.-3-1266","jurisdiction":"us-az","citation":"A.R.S. § 3-1266","heading":"Fees for recording, rerecording and leasing","body":"The fee for recording a brand and earmark shall be seventy-five dollars and shall entitle the owner to a certified copy of the record. For recording a bill of sale or other instrument of conveyance of a brand and mark, the fee shall be twenty-five dollars. For issuance of an additional certified copy of a brand or bill of sale of a brand, the fee shall be ten dollars. The fee for rerecording a brand and earmark shall be fifty dollars. The fee for leasing a brand from the division for a period of not to exceed one year for use on transient livestock shall be two hundred dollars.","path":["Title 3 Agriculture"],"source_url":"https://www.azleg.gov/ars/3/01266.htm","current_through":"2026-09-04","vintage":"2026-08-09","retrieved_at":"2026-09-04T00:49:56Z","sha256":"409fdecf7d6cdbeb414e2c83a7522ebcd21adb445df04327b79002818e51fb92","source_id":"us-az","stale":true,"prev":"us-az/a.r.s.-3-1265","next":"us-az/a.r.s.-3-1267"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
